Work for common people`s interest, not to topple government, PM tells her rival

DHAKA: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ina Sunday advised opposition leader Khaleda Zia to call a halt to movement for ousting the government and work for the common people`s interest.

"Stop the heinous politics of killing people and prepare the ground for serving people’s interest," said Hasina, in a sharp rebuttal to her political archrival’s observations made Saturday at her party’s executive committee meeting that time is ripe for anti-government mass movement.


The Prime Minister was speaking at the inaugural function of a voluntary blood donation programme organized by Bangladesh Krishak League at Dhanmondi to mark the beginning of the mourning month August with its President Mirza Abdul Jalil in the chair.
“Try to attain people’s confidence and trust and take a vow for not committing corruption and patronizing militancy," she further said in her advice.
"Being a Muslim how Khaleda Zia gives direction for burning another Muslim to death?" She posed a question.


She also said the opposition leader is trying to create the ground for toppling government by killing people as the Awami League-led grand-alliance government is running the country “fairly”.


She warned that the countrymen wouldn’t vote to power those who “committed corruption, plundering, and killings and created militancy” in the country.
The PM also urged her party leaders and workers to work for the people with the spirit and ideology of Father of the Nation Bangabandhu Sheikh Mujibur Rahman to build up a happy, prosperous Bangladesh.


Awami League Presidium Member and Agriculture Minister Matia Chowdhury, Joint General Secretary Mahbub-ul-Alam Hanif, Awami League advisory council member Advocate Rahmat Ali, Food Minister Dr Abdur Razzak, Health Minister Professor Dr AFM Ruhal Haque and General Secretary of Krishak League Motahar Hossain Mollah, among others, also spoke at the programme.
